Difference between revisions of "AXY:MC-Basic:group.POSITIONERRORSETTLE"
| Line 37: | Line 37: | ||
* [[MC-Basic:ATTACH|ATTACH]] | * [[MC-Basic:ATTACH|ATTACH]] | ||
* [[MC-Basic:group.ISSETTLED|group.ISSETTLED]] | * [[MC-Basic:group.ISSETTLED|group.ISSETTLED]] | ||
| − | * [[ | + | * [[MC-Basic:group.POSITIONERROR|group.POSITIONERROR]] |
* [[Axystems:MC-Basic:group.TIMESETTLE|group.TIMESETTLE]] | * [[Axystems:MC-Basic:group.TIMESETTLE|group.TIMESETTLE]] | ||
* [[Axystems:MC-Basic:group.TIMESETTLEMAX|group.TIMESETTLEMAX]] | * [[Axystems:MC-Basic:group.TIMESETTLEMAX|group.TIMESETTLEMAX]] | ||
Revision as of 08:51, 22 May 2014
This property specifies the range of position among the group which defines the group as being settled. When the motion profiler has completed, the absolute value of the position error (Target Position - Actual Position) is compared to the PESETTLE property. If the the result is less than or equal to this property for the time given by TIMESETTLE, the ISSETTLED flag is set.
Short form
<group>.PESettle
Syntax
<group>.PositionErrorSettle = <expression>
?<group>.PositionErrorSettle
Availability
All versions
Type
Double
Range
0 to Max Double
Units
User axis position units, as given by <axis>.POSITIONFACTOR.
Default
MaxDouble
Scope
Task or Terminal
Limitations
To set the value within a task, the group must be attached to that task (using the ATTACH command).
Examples
XyTable.PESettle =0.0144